Marquette's game against second-ranked Connecticut tonight at the Bradley Center is the most coveted ticket in town since the Brewers' playoff series against Philadelphia. Fans are going to extreme measures to secure seats to the nationally-televised game, and Bootleggers, 1023 N. Old World 3rd St., is more than willing to help.
Bootleggers is sponsoring a "Get a Buzz Cut for Buzz" promotion. Marquette fans willing to switch to a hairstyle similar to that of Golden Eagles' coach Buzz Williams can win tickets to the game.
The event starts at 2 p.m. Three winners will be chosen based on hair length and on which change will be the most drastic. Sport Clips representatives will provide the three winners with a professional buzz cut, then the radio station and Miller Lite will provide each winner with a pair of tickets to the game.
Winners will be determined by 4 p.m., during a live broadcast of "The World's Greatest Sports Talk Show" with Steve "The Homer" True.
